Located just a 1-minute walk from Fujimidai Station on the Seibu Ikebukuro Line, this dental clinic celebrated 24 years since opening in May 2025 and has treated approximately 11,700 patients to date. Following a complete renovation in May 2017, the clinic introduced state-of-the-art equipment including digital X-rays, extraoral suction, full sterilization systems, AED and ECG monitors, and laser treatment, while also implementing barrier-free accessibility with a ramp at the entrance. Subsequently, CT X-ray machines (May 2018), microscopes (January 2019), and intraoral scanners (November 2021) were successively introduced, demonstrating ongoing commitment to cutting-edge medical technology. As a designated physician for disability treatment and feeding/swallowing rehabilitation cooperation with the Nerima Dental Association, the clinic is deeply involved in community healthcare through home visits and actively collaborates with medical institutions as a diabetes liaison physician and oral cancer screening cooperation physician. Treatment begins only after thorough consultation with patients, obtaining informed consent using dental models, microscopes, and intraoral cameras. During initial visits, patients complete a medical history questionnaire to establish clear treatment plans. The clinic has established a system for safe patient care, including referrals to secondary medical institutions when necessary.
